Summary

Under limited supervision, directs all facets of the operations of the school’s office including student registration and records, class schedules, special education compliance and deadlines, graduation clearance, and other related matters. Plans and develops strategies for maintenance and upgrading of academic information infrastructure.

About the Position

  • Maintains and upgrades the school’s academic information infrastructures including academic records archives (paper and electronic), on-line student database (Infinite Campus), student’s special education paperwork and timelines (Enrich data system), daily attendance, other electronic databases and information systems for all students.

  • Establishes and implements short- and long-range department goals, objectives, policies, and operating procedures; monitors and evaluates program effectiveness; effects changes required for improvement.

  • Represents the school to various hospital departments as well as externally to governmental agencies, vendors, students, parents, and/or the general public.

  • Recommends and participates in the development of school policies and procedures; may serve on hospital planning and policy-making committees.

  • Collaborates with representatives of the Colorado Department of Education, and other national, state, and local organizations on the development and implementation of new requirements and practices.

  • Performs miscellaneous job-related duties as assigned.
